WebThe ethic of personal moral integrity. The introduction of the ethic of personal moral integrity acknowledges the awareness that the application of each of the previous ethical perspectives is more likely to provide a multiplicity of alternative actions rather than precipitate a singular best solution to the ethical dilemma. Give reasons.(150 Words) General The self-integration and identity views of integrity see it asprimarily a personal matter: a quality defined by a person’scare of the self. Cheshire Calhoun argues that integrity is primarilya social virtue, one that is defined by a person’s relations toothers (Calhoun 1995). The social character of integrity is, … Zobraziť viac On the self-integration view of integrity, integrity is a matter ofpersons integrating various parts of their personality into aharmonious, intact whole.
